T-Mobile for Business: 5G in Logistics Capabilities Supply chains around the world have become increasingly complex in recent years, with strategies constantly shifting to meet new global expectations and a demand for more visibility.

Levels of visibility across the supply chain can be the decider between operational resilience and supply chain risk, but when a network is constantly on the move or is spread out across the world, high levels of visibility can feel out of reach.
